El Prado Estates has an obesity rate of 39.7%, which is 3.6pp above the national average. The depression rate is 17.6%, 5.9pp below the national average. About 26.9% of adults lack health insurance. 71.9% of residents had an annual checkup in the past year. There are 2 hospitals nearby. 2 offer emergency services. The average CMS quality rating is 2.0 out of 5.
